Key Facts
- Crnogorski Telekom is in the country of Montenegro[3].
- Crnogorski Telekom's instance of is recorded as telecommunication company[4].
- Crnogorski Telekom's instance of is recorded as public company[5].
- Crnogorski Telekom is owned by Magyar Telekom[6].
- Crnogorski Telekom is owned by Deutsche Telekom[7].
- Crnogorski Telekom's headquarters location is recorded as Podgorica[8].
- Crnogorski Telekom's stock exchange is recorded as Montenegro Stock Exchange[9].
- Crnogorski Telekom's industry is recorded as telecommunications[10].
- Crnogorski Telekom's industry is recorded as mobile phone industry[11].
- December 31, 1998 marks the founding of Crnogorski Telekom[12].
- Crnogorski Telekom's parent organization or unit is recorded as Magyar Telekom[13].
- Crnogorski Telekom's parent organization or unit is recorded as Deutsche Telekom[14].
- Crnogorski Telekom's official website is recorded as https://www.telekom.me/[15].
- Crnogorski Telekom's product or material produced is recorded as landline telephone[16].
- Crnogorski Telekom's legal form is recorded as joint-stock company[17].
- Crnogorski Telekom's mobile network code is recorded as 02[18].
